Small correction: the fuse module does (of course, stupid me) exist per default, but points b and c remain valid, failure must be properly handled.i.e. we have multiple errors combined to make a big mess: a. grub-mount relies on a fuse module which doesn't exist (by default). b. it fails with an error message but a successful return code. c. 50mounted-tests thinks that the command is successful (and hides the error message which could have been helpful).
